New Delhi – The curious case of micro-blogging site Twitter arbitrarily suspending nationalistic Twitter accounts continued as this time it locked the account of ‘OpIndia-Hindi’ for reporting facts and exposing ‘liberal-secular’ media’s dubious propaganda on Delhi’s anti-Hindu riots.

On 8th March, OpIndia-Hindi posted an investigative report on how Muslim mobs had carried out a meticulous plan a few days prior to the communal riots and had exposed the claim of the ‘liberal-secular’ media who propagated the false narrative of Muslims being the ‘victims’ despite being perpetrators.

As per Twitter, writing about the fate of 10 Hindus who had to face the brunt in the Delhi anti-Hindu riots is ‘hateful conduct’. Following the suspension of the account for 12 hours, Twitter gave a clarification that the account had promoted violence or threatened other people on the basis of race, ethnicity, national origin, etc. However, it did not provide any specific reason before arbitrarily suspending the account.

Not only this, the personal account of OpIndia-Hindi Editor, Ajeet Bharti, was also locked for 12 hours because of his tweet to ‘journalist’ Saba Naqvi.
